Introduction to Irrigation Wheel Drive Gearbox

An irrigation wheel drive gearbox is a crucial component of mechanized irrigation systems like center pivot and lateral move systems. It is responsible for transferring power from the water pressure or electric motor to the wheels, enabling the irrigation system to move across the field.
